Suppose U = {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10} is the universal set and G = {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7}. What is G?
Nesterboy [21]
Your posted question defines G, then asks what G is.
G is the set in the definition you gave.

G = {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7}

_____
Perhaps you want to know the complement of G. That is all the elements of U that are not in G.

G' = {8, 9, 10}
